Maryland Statutes

§ 12-112

Maryland·Article grp Real Property·Title 12
(a)If land is acquired, in whole or in part, by condemnation or by purchase in lieu of condemnation, any person at whose expense any personal property, dead body, grave marker, or monument must be removed as a reasonably necessary consequence of condemnation, or purchase in lieu of condemnation, is entitled to receive from the condemnor or purchaser a pecuniary allowance for the reasonable costs of removing and placing the item or body in another location within a reasonable distance. In order to receive the pecuniary allowance the person shall submit his claim to the condemnor or purchaser within six months after the removal of the personal property, dead body, grave marker, or monument with respect to which he claims pecuniary allowance.
